Fuman Intelij-Plugin für PhpStorm
Für ein erfülltes Programmiererlebnis mit dem PhpStorm von JetBrains kann ein Plugin installiert werden.
Installation
Mit dem Pluginmanager vom PhpStorm den Ordner admin/intellij aufsuchen und dort die Datei fuman_intellij_plugin.jar auswählen.
Nach dem Installieren und Neustart des PhpStorm kann nun in der Konfiguration unter «fuman» die URL zur «fuman-livedoc» eingetragen werden.
Die «fuman-livedoc»-Url ist im Fuman-Backend als Systemadministrator unter System → Livedoc ersichtlich.
Funktionen
Das Plugin stellt folgende Funktionen zur Verfügung.
- Fuman Template (Syntax Highlightning, Validation, Autocompletion)
- Skeleton generierung (SHIFT + CTRL + F6)
- Kickstarter (SHIFT + CTRL + F6)
Livedoc aktualisieren: «SHIFT + CTRL + F5»
Für die Code/Skeleton-Generierung wird die Livedoc verwendet. Deshalb sollte nach jeder Änderung an dem DB-Layout die Livedoc per SHIFT + CTRL + F5 aktualisiert werden.
Code/Skeleton-Generierung: «SHIFT + CTRL + F6»
- Kickstarter: Webseiten (Frontend) Zugangspunkt (index.php & .htaccess), Basis Seiten (page) Aktion (Fuman_Frontend_Action_Sitemap), App Kofiugration (config.php im Projekt-App) und führt folgende Sub-Aufgaben aus: Frontend-Theme,
- Frontend Theme: Erstellt eine Theme Struktur unter dem Anzugebenden Namen
- Fuman Action: Erstellt ein Backend Action Skeleton
- Fuman Frontend Action: ....